    We are an independent charity, part of the Age Concern Federation, working to improve the quality of life for all older people in and around the city of Norwich regardless of gender, ethnic origin or sexual orientation. Registered Charity no: 1094623

  • Age Concern Norwich has changed its working name to Age UK Norwich, following the merger of Age Concern England and Help the Aged to form Age UK. Our new logo and name are being introduced as old copies are used up.

    Many other local, independent Age Concerns across the country will be forming a partnership with Age UK over the coming months and changing their own name and logo.
